Cost

Replacing your car keys can be a challenge. It can be expensive and time-consuming, no matter whether you've lost your keys or need an extra. Audi offers an easy method to get your car's keys replaced.

The cost of replacing an Audi key will vary based on which Audi model you choose to drive and the dealer from whom you purchase them. It is essential to know where to go when you need a replacement audi key in order to save money and avoid unnecessary expenditures.

A good place to start is to talk to your local dealer. You might be able to find a list of locksmiths near you who can assist you. They can also assist you to select the best locksmith for your vehicle.

It may be more difficult to cut your Audi key if you are using an older model. These models require laser cutting technology in order to open the ignition key cylinder as well as lock. This technology is not readily available in all hardware stores, and only a few locksmiths in the automotive industry have it.

Most Audi dealerships will charge a minimum of $280 and a maximum of $475 for the new key, but they may also charge additional programming fees that can be quite costly. Before you decide it's a good idea to visit multiple dealerships in your local area to compare prices.

Whatever the source of your key, it's important to know the VIN number. This information will help the locksmith or dealer locate the exact vehicle and make sure that the new key fits correctly.

Transponder Keys

Audi cars are among the most luxurious on the market. They also come with a variety of features that make driving them more relaxing. This includes keyless entry technology that allows owners to enter their car without needing to reach for their keys or tap the buttons on the dashboard.

The majority of Audis are now built with high-security "chip keys' with transponder chips embedded in the head of the key blade. The keys are programmed with unique codes and are designed to disable the immobiliser system of the vehicle located in the engine control unit (ECU).

When you put your key in the ignition, an antenna ring sends out a radio frequency signal to the chip that is inside the key. The chip absorbs the energy, then transmits a unique number within the dashboard of your car.

The car's computer will then compare the code with its own memory, and if it is compatible, the immobiliser is disabled so that the car can begin. If it doesn't match, the security light will light up and the driver has to call a locksmith to make new keys.
